OTDR Port Quality Check
OptiFiber is the only OTDR to incorporate an automated port quality check that warns the user when the OTDR port is dirty or contaminated. This is an important feature that can save users time while delivering a higher level of confidence in the OTDR test results. Over 70% of fiber test results that are inaccurate are due to dirty port connections, which means you may be spending hours trying to find the problem when the problem is in the port, not the fiber link.
OTDR port quality test automatically displays and evaluates the quality of the optical connection at the OTDR port with a Poor, Fair or Good rating. If the connection quality is poor or fair, a warning message appears so you can fix it before you do your OTDR testing.

General OptiFiber Specifications | |
Weight | Main with module and battery: 4.5 lb (1.9 kg) |
Dimensions | Main with module and battery: 11.4 x 7.5 x 2.5 in (29.0 x 19/1 x 6.4 cm) |
Battery | Li Ion |
Battery Life | 8 hr typical |
Connections | USB, RS-232, PS-2 keyboard, Fiber Inspector Camera |
Memory Card | SD MMC (128 MB maximum) |
Operating Temperature | O °C to 40 °C (35 °C in continuous Real Time Trace |
Key OTDR Specifications (23ºC) | Singlemode: OFTM-5732 |
Output/Input Connector | SC/UPC Removable/Cleanable |
Wavelengths | 1310 ± 25nm and 1550 ± 30nm |
Fiber Under Test | 9/125µm singlemode |
Event Deadzones | 1310/1550nm: 1m typical |
Attenuation Deadzone | 1310/1550nm: 8m typical |
Pulse Width | 1310/1550 nm: 5ns, 20ns, 40ns, 100ns, 300ns, 1us, 3us, 10us |
Max Distance Range | 1310nm/1550nm: 60km |
Dynamic Range | 1310 nm: >26 dB 1550 nm: >24 dB |
Testing Speed for MultiMode Modules | Auto OTDR 15 seconds Typical Manual OTDR 15 seconds to 3 min |
Output Power | 1310nm >28mW-pk 1550nm >24mW-pk |
Distance Accuracy | |
Loss Threshold | .01 dB to 1.5 dB inclusive |
Linearity | +-.05dB/dB |
Sample Spacing | 3cm to 400cm |
Reflectance Accuracy | +- 4dB |
ORL Accuracy | +- 4dB |
Key OTDR Specifications for OFTM-5612B | |
Output/Input Connector | SC/UPC/Removeable/Cleanable |
Wavelengths | 850 ± 20nm and 1300 ± 20nm |
Fiber Under Test | 50/125µm or 62.5/125µm multimode |
Event Deadzones | 850nm: 0.5m typical 1300nm: 1.3m typical |
Attenuation Deadzone | 850nm: 4.5m typical 1300nm: 10.5m typical |
Pulse Width | 850 nm: 4 ns, 20 ns 1300 nm: 8 ns, 40 ns, 100 ns, 200 ns, 400 ns, 650 ns |
Max Distance Range | 850nm: 3 km 1300nm: 7 km |
Dynamic Range | 850 nm: >15 dB 1300 nm: >14 dB |
Testing Speed for MultiMode Modules | <10s for two wavelengths at 2 km with 25 cm resolution <30s for two wavelengths at 400 m with 3 cm resolution |
Output Power | 850nm >110mW-pk 1300 >22mW-pk |
Distance Accuracy | +- 1m +- 0.005% of distance+-50% of resolution +-IOR error +-event location |
Loss Threshold | .2dB |
Linearity | +- .07dB/dB |
Sample Spacing | 3cm to 50cm |
Reflectance Accuracy | +- 4dB |
ORL Accuracy | +- 4dB |
